The Associated and Catholic Colleges of WA is committed to working with our members to ensure that school sport can recommence as quickly and safely as possible. Following the lifting of restrictions in line with WA’s Phase 4 roadmap, schools can further ease restrictions on school sport  as of the 27th June 2020. 

The most important aspect of a return to school sport and recreation is the health and welfare of our students, other members of our school communities and external providers.

To help facilitate a safe return process and mitigate the risk of COVID-19, the ACC has developed ACC Sport COVID-19 Safety resource materials; guidelines, plans, checklists and certificates. These documents are in template and generic form so they can be used by schools for their own COVID-19 Safety Planning.

The ACC is recommending that the following steps be enacted to prepare for the recommencement of school sport.

1.   Appoint a School COVID-19 Safety Officer:  To oversee the sport safety planning and implementation for the school. 

2.   Review the ACC COVID-19 Sport Guidelines: The school COVID-19 safety officer, Head of Sport or COVID-19 safety committee should review the ACC Sport and Recreation COVID-19 Safety Guidelines. The guidelines provide a detailed overview of the protocols that should be in place by sport and recreation organisations to ensure a safe return to sport.

3.   Complete and implement the ACC 10 Point Checklist: The 10-point return to school sport checklist should be reviewed and signed off by each school before re-commencing school sport training or matches. The 10 points on the checklist form the basis of the key safety requirements that the school has an obligation to implement.

4.   Safety Plan: The school should consider voluntarily completing a COVID-19 Sport and Recreation Safety Plan and displaying a COVID Safety certificate at school sport venues.

5.  Review your sport safety protocols and plan accordingly. The COVID-19 pandemic is an evolving situation – review your plan regularly and make changes as required.
